Yes, hand wash. Clean the top with a sponge, soap and water (303 cleaner does work, but isn’t necessary) Let the top thoroughly dry and then coat with 303 fabric guard (twice, with a foam roller) You can use a REAL horsehair brush to clean of pollen dust etc. (sold on Amazon) Clearly, use a lint roller for lint.
